Part No. W989D2DBJX6I
Manufacturer: Winbond
Category: DRAM
Description: DRAM 512Mb LPSDR, x32, 166MHz, Ind Temp, 46nm
Datasheet: W989D2DBJX6I Datasheet (PDF)
